LINE valves come first in the European Product Design Award competition

Our contribution to Nordic design has been recognized globally since LINE valves received a gold medal for the best HVAC product in the design competition. The European Product Design Award™ rewards international product and industrial designers. The competition’s international jury evaluates the design based on innovation, aesthetics, functionality, durability, and usefulness.

The collection of VIVA wall diffusers received an honorable mention in 2021, and LINE valves are now the second innovation to reach such recognition in the ventilation field at the European Product Design Award competition.

LINE is a stylish and advanced valve for residential premises. The collection has been developed in collaboration with industrial design and interior design professionals and Climecon’s ventilation experts. Minna Haapakoski, a distinguished design professional and interior designer who has been providing interior design services for private and public spaces for 15 years, was involved in the product development project of our LINE collection.

The starting point for the cooperation was to combine interior design and ventilation with stylish valves. With the LINE collection, products’ streamlined graphic shapes and the materials seen in ventilation for the first time offer architects, interior designers, and those building and renovating their own houses extensive opportunities to finish an interior decor with valves. Minimalistic shapes and classic color options are timeless and versatile in interior design.

Vent. X tips – adding obstacles

Obstacles in the path of the air flow affect the throw patterns of the air terminal devices. By modeling the obstacles in the space, their effect on the throw pattern of the selected air terminal device and the air movement can be studied. This information helps to choose the right air terminal devices for the space and to place them optimally so for example, the airflow turning down from the barrier does not cause draft problems.
